When the digitally shot, three-dimensional film Hannah Montana/Miley Cyrus: Best of Both Worlds Concertraked in $31 million on its opening weekend earlier this year, it served as both wake-up call and warning for the owners of the United States' 6,000 theaters, which are about to undergo the most expensive and risky makeover since movies went to sound or color. Studios and theater owners are going digital. If Hollywood and the Motion Picture Association of America get their wish, it could cost studios and theater owners upwards of $1billion. And there's no guarantee it will revive an industry that hasn't seen an attendance increase in the past three years. But that won't stop studios from trying...
